The Serpent 966-TE evolves the 1/8 on-road concept introduced by the Serpent 960, offering a Team Edition chassis tailored for high level competition. It focuses on durability, precise handling and a wide range of setup options that experienced racers expect.
The 966-TE uses a 5mm 7075-T6 aluminium chassis to achieve the stiffness needed for repeatable performance. Its independent double wishbone suspension and RCC-X shock units deliver controlled handling and predictable feedback. The split carbon radio plate allows measured flex adjustment to influence balance and turn-in.
Fitted with an SL8 light 2-speed gearbox, the chassis benefits from reduced rotating inertia for crisper acceleration. The Centax-II clutch system includes external gap adjustment for reliable engagement. Rear suspension geometry is adjustable, including roll centre and camber rise settings to suit track layout.
The design supports thorough setup work, with options to alter camber, caster, toe-in, track width and wheelbase to match surface grip and driving technique. Quality bearings across the drivetrain reduce friction, and the quick-release wheels speed up tyre changes during meetings.
For racers aiming to extract lap time through setup and component choice, the Serpent 966-TE offers a robust, tuneable foundation suited to serious competition.
